Absolutely loved my experience at Yukga Korean BBQ on Sahara Ave! From the moment we walked in, the service was warm, attentive, and fast. The restaurant has a sleek, modern vibe but still feels cozy and inviting. The quality of the meats was top-tier — every cut was fresh, well-marinated, and cooked perfectly on the grill right at our table. I especially loved the brisket and marinated short rib, but everything was delicious. The side dishes (banchan) were flavorful and plentiful, and they kept them coming without us even having to ask. The dipping sauces added great depth to the meats, and the kimchi was some of the best I’ve had in Vegas. Whether you’re new to Korean BBQ or a seasoned fan, Yukga delivers an authentic and memorable dining experience. It’s perfect for a casual dinner or a fun night out with friends. Highly recommend — we’ll definitely be back!

I used to love going to Hobak when they first opened, but after they raised their prices so much, I stopped going. I’m so happy that Yukga opened because it’s like how Hobak used to be when it was reasonably priced.
I was a little worried before coming because I saw some reviews about rude customer service, but that was not true at all for us. Everyone who helped us was kind and smiling the whole time. The staff member who took our order was especially great. He kept recommending dishes and even suggested how we should order so we could try more variety. He was very polite, funny, and made the experience even better.
All of the meat was really tender and soft, with nothing too chewy. We especially loved the cold noodles at the end. The noodles were super chewy and delicious. The ice cream at the end was the perfect way to finish the meal.
I’m really glad we came here, and I would definitely come back again!
